7) A particle’s position along the x-axis is described by x(t) = A t + B t², where t is in seconds, x is in meters, and the constants A and B are given below.

Randomized Variables

A = -4.8 m/s

B = 7.9 m/s2

a) What is the velocity, in meters per second, of the particle at the time t1 =3.0s? 

b) What is the velocity, in meters per second, of the particle when it is at the origin (x = 0) at time t0 > 0?
